Attention, pizza lovers! Pizza Hut has announced that it will extend its $2 pizza deal, giving you more time to satisfy your hunger without spending much money. The promotion has received a positive response from fans of the chain, so the company decided to listen and treat them with more days to enjoy it. If you haven’t taken advantage of the deal yet, here are all the details.

When will Pizza Hut’s $2 pizza deal end?

The promotion began on July 8 and was originally scheduled to end at the end of the month; however, it will now be extended. So far, the company hasn’t specified the exact end date for the promotion, so it’s best not to wait too long to take advantage of it.

How to get $2 pizza at Pizza Hut?

The offer is valid only on Tuesdays for carryout orders, whether you order online, at participating restaurants, or through the app. You can redeem this deal with the purchase of a personal pizza with one topping. Additional toppings cost 69 cents each (except for cheese, which costs an extra 50 cents).

According to the chain, the offer is limited to a maximum of four pizzas per customer, with no additional purchase required and while supplies last.

What is Pizza Hut’s most popular pizza?

Pizza Hut restaurants offer a wide selection of pizzas, but some of their specialties have earned a place as the most popular among customers. Here are the five most popular pizzas from the chain:

  1. Supreme Pizza
  2. Meat Lover’s Pizza
  3. Pepperoni Lover’s Pizza
  4. Veggie Lover’s Pizza
  5. Cheese Pizza

History of Pizza Hut

Pizza Hut, part of Yum! Brands, Inc., was founded in 1958 in WichitaKansas. From the beginning, it has been a pioneer in innovation, introducing iconic products such as the Original Pan Pizza and the Original Stuffed Crust Pizza.

In 1994, Pizza Hut made history by placing the first online food order. Today, it continues to lead the way in technology and digital platforms, with more than half of its global transactions coming from digital orders.

How many Pizza Hut locations are there?

The famous pizza chain operates over 19,000 restaurants in more than 100 countries worldwide.

What is Hut Rewards?

Hut Rewards is the company’s loyalty program that offers points for every dollar spent on food, regardless of how the order is placed. Hut Rewards is available to U.S. residents aged 18 and over.

What is the number 1 pizza chain in the U.S.?

Domino’s is the largest pizza chain in the United States, having positioned itself as the favorite among pizza consumers.

What is the most ordered pizza in the U.S.?

Pepperoni pizza. Pepperoni is the most popular pizza topping in the U.S. The traditional cheese pizza ranks second, followed by veggie pizza in third.
